Cyclone hits Tonga but only minor damage reported

6:17 pm on 28 January 2003

Cyclone Cilla has hit Tonga's Ha'apai group of islands but only minor damage to buildings and some destruction of crops is reported at this stage.

Male'u Takai, the deputy director of the National Disaster Office, says the defence force on the main Ha'apai island of Lifuka has been in radio contact and there have been no reports of any injuries or deaths.

"Damage to building infrastructure is very minor, fruit bearing trees are the ones affected like breadfruit, coconut trees. The power is now working so that is a good sign to us but communication between Tongatapu and Haapai is still down."

Mr Takai says there's been no contact with other islands in the Ha'apai group as yet.
